Health Secretary Duque visits UST Hospital’s ceremonial vaccination against COVID-19

 

Department of Health Secretary Dr. Francisco T. Duque, III, visited the University of Santo Tomas Hospital (USTH) to inspect its vaccination rollout on March 11, 2020. Duque, a graduate of the UST Faculty of Medicine and Surgery, also led the ceremonial vaccination where the Prior Provincial of the Dominican Province of the Philippines and Chairman of the Board of Trustees of the UST Hospital, Very Rev. Fr. Filemon I. Dela Cruz, Jr., O.P., received the COVID-19 jab.

The inoculation against COVID-19 for UST Hospital’s over 1,500 personnel began during its 75th Anniversary held on March 7, 2021. As of publication date, all workers who registered for COVID-19 vaccination were able to get their first dose according to UST COVID-19 Vaccine Logistics Task Force Head Dr. John Hubert Pua. The second dose of Sinovac would be given after four weeks, while AstraZeneca’s second dose is after eight to ten weeks.

On USTH’s diamond jubilee, the top administrators, namely the Chief Executive Officer Rev. Fr. Julius Paul C. Factora, O.P., Medical Director Dr. Charito Malong-Consolacion, and Director for Administration Analin Empaynado-Porto, Ph.D., led the ceremonial vaccination.
